Qual è la differenza tra Int e Bigint in SQL?
Qual è la differenza tra Int e Bigint in SQL?

Video: Qual è la differenza tra Int e Bigint in SQL?

Video: Qual è la differenza tra Int e Bigint in SQL?
Video: MySQL : What is the difference between tinyint, smallint, mediumint, bigint and int in MySQL? 2024, Novembre
Anonim

L'intervallo senza segno è compreso tra 0 e 18446744073709551615. Ok, bene an INT può memorizzare un valore a 2,1 miliardi e un a BIGINT può memorizzare un valore in un numero più grande di 20 cifre. Tipi numerici in cui troviamo che INT è un 4 byte numero intero , e a BIGINT è un 8 byte numero intero.

Di conseguenza, cos'è un Bigint in SQL?

Il BigInt tipo di dati in SQL Il server è la rappresentazione a 64 bit di un numero intero. Occupa 8 byte di memoria. Può variare da -2^63 (-9, 223, 372, 036, 854, 775, 808) a 2^63 (9, 223, 372, 036, 854, 775, 807). SQL Al server piacciono gli indici ristretti e prevedibili.

qual è la differenza tra Int e Smallint? I valori INTEGER hanno 32 bit e possono rappresentare numeri interi da -2 31da –1 a 2 31–1. SMALLINT i valori hanno solo 16 bit. Possono rappresentare numeri interi da –32, 767 a 32, 767.

Inoltre, cos'è un Bigint?

Un numero intero grande è un numero intero binario con una precisione di 63 bit. Il BIGINT il tipo di dati può rappresentare numeri interi a 63 bit ed è compatibile con tutti i tipi di dati numerici. Il BIGINT La funzione restituisce una rappresentazione di un numero intero grande o una rappresentazione di stringa di un numero.

Quanto è grande un Bigint?

8 byte

Consigliato: